They took my washer from my old house, moved it to my new house, barely attached the washer hose, turned on the water so it was spilling down the wall, and then pushed the washer back in place to cover the leaking and left. They told no one that they even turned on the water. When I arrived at my new house 24 hours later, my floors were completely destroyed. It cost me over $6000. They said it was my fault because they aren't plumbers and don't know any better. I informed them that you don't hire plumbers to attach a washing machine hose and if they were so inept, they shouldn't have touched it in the first place. They refused all responsibility and said they would pay nothing.Business Response
Date: 12/15/2023
My Town Movers was very clear we will assist in disconnect and reconnect of the customers washer and dryer at the customers request however we are not licensed plumbers and do it simply as a courtesy. We are very clear it is up to the customer to double check everything before running any loads of laundry to make sure there are no leaks. We did not turn the water on, that was done by the customer. If there was a leak the customer should have turned the water off immediately. We are very clear that My Town Movers takes Zero lability in connection of water lines which is all included in our paperwork and need to know emails we sent them. This claim was reviewed by our insurance company and after reviewing all of our Need to know emails the customer received as well as the legal forms they also deemed it was the customers fault. I understand the customer is upset but it was their responsibility to check over all water connections. Additionally we did not turn the water onCustomer Answer

I hired My Town Movers in the later part of January 2022. I paid my deposit to secure a move date. I was told that I need to notify them in so many hours if I needed to change my move date and they did not answer the call on the saturday prior to my monday move. When I discussed this with them on monday they advised I would have to pay another fee so I had them to move some smaller items to my small storage. They rescheduled my new move date but could not complete the move. I questioned this and they advised they did not have the man-power to complete the move. The manager finally agreed for the 4 men to complete to move but I actually had to hire a second moving company to complete the move and when they arrived they were reluctant to move my furniture as almost all of it was broken. Almost all of the furniture was damaged and was not able to be moved and this caused me to have to keep storage for longer than I expected. Mt Town would not discuss a resolution to compensate me for the damaged and broken furniture. They requested photos via email and I sent them. They then advised I could not confirmer the movers caused the damage ??? :-( . I have a $1500 antique piece that has a broken leg. They broke my marble table, they lost all parts to the bedroom furniture and this cause me to have to purchase additional furniture 4-6 weeks later they found marble tops to night stands and reached out to see if they were mine. They broke the marble inlay to another antique piece. They broke the headboard to my Rococo bed and all other furniture is scarred up so bad I will need to refinish them. What a horrible experience. They basically advised they were not going to compensate me as they were not professional movers and their fee is $250 + an hour and you have to pay for at lease 4 hours. I am requesting to be compensated for my damaged and broken furniture. I am requesting for the fees I have had to pay for storage as well as compensation for broken , damaged and lost itemsBusiness Response

************* was originally quoted just under $2000 to pack and move her furniture in two separate days. She rescheduled her move multiple times including once inside of our 72 hour cancellation period which left our crew and truck without work on her schedule moving date which is why she did forfeit the $150 deposit. We Booked her for another packing day and on the day of the pack she called to cancel last minute as the crew was leaving the office. We informed her we would have to charge her another cancellation fee in which she replied she did not want to lose another cancellation fee so we agreed to use that time to move some additional items that were not originally part of the quote in which she did sign a contract for an hourly rate. She was only charged a three hour minimum for that job. We came back on the day of the original scheduled Move date and supplied labor at our hourly rate which was agreed-upon. All of her moves were by the hour which was agreed-upon and signed for. She was given a ballpark price for the main move of $1224 and the actual move Took a little bit longer than estimated because nothing was packed and items were loose. The bill on that day only came out to be $1403 but again it was not a flat rate price it was an hourly rate.We are very clear with our insurance policy and My Town Movers does not Insure items being moved into a customers own truck, POD, container or storage unit. ************* moved into a storage unit which she understood was 100% at her own risk. Not only did we inform her that we would not be able to Insure the items going into storage, we also sent her an email notifying her of all of our policies prior to the move and she signed A contract with us which included the exclusion of coverage moving into storage units as well as excepting the charges of the job.In addition to moving items into a storage unit which is outside of our coverage the customer also hired another moving company to move her out of the storage unit. My Town Movers has no way to know who damaged items since we were not the last company to handle the furniture. I apologize for her dissatisfaction but the move was completely unorganized on her end. She was not packed, flaky on dates and had other movers handling her furniture. My Town Movers provided the services agreed-upon and the customer was aware that moving into a storage unit was at their own risk.
Please see the attached estimate that the customer sent prior to the move which they agreed to that includes our disclaimer. as well as the standard disclaimer on every contract for every job we send out.
